Limerick boss McDonald: Pressure all on Cork City

SSE Airtricity League: Limerick manager Neil McDonald insists “the pressure is all on Cork” as he prepares for his first Munster derby at Turner’s Cross tonight (8pm, live on eirSport2).

“It’s really good to go and play the champions-elect. It’s going to be a very, very difficult game for us to play away from home. But we’re not going in with a defeatist attitude. We’re going to try to upset, try to create and try to win the game,” McDonald told LimerickFC.ie.

“The pressure is all on Cork. When you’ve won 16 out of your 17 games, you’re expected to win. Everyone keeps on telling me this is a Munster derby, so it’s important we try to perform well against the top team in the league, and if we can get some points that would be fantastic. It would give us huge confidence for the rest of the season.”
